1st International Swiss-India webinar on primary cleft care in infants

 

This webinar delivered by Dr. Andreas Mueller on the concepts of passive plate therapy in infants for the partner centre in Chennai was attended by 40 members from Chennai Cleft centre, India, Nepal, UK and the teams from Basel and ETH Zurich. The participants for the webinar comprised a complete range of health care disciplines involved in the cleft care. Dr. Mueller gave a historical overview of how various pre-surgical plate therapies have evolved, each through distinct targeted outcome effects. He presented the favourable effect of passive plate therapy on the natural development of palatal morphology which subsequently facilitates the one-stage surgery of cleft lip and palate. The webinar was well received by the participants with an active interaction and exchange of ideas on different concepts of passive plate therapy and surgery in reducing the burden of care.
